How To Remove Viruses From My Computer

At this moment someone is hard at work inventing a virus to destroy your computer.

Eugene Kaspersky, whose company, Kaspersky Lab Virus Research, works to fight virus proliferation says, "The number of new viruses and Trojans is now increasing every day by a few hundred. Our virus lab receives between 200 and 300 new samples a day."

Like biological viruses that infect human beings, computer viruses can vary from mild to severe.

The approach to dealing with this malware, an abbreviation for "malicious software" is to prepare well in advance. You do not want to become aware of the problem after you have lost most of your files.

Prevention And Data Recovery Preparation

Here are some essential tips for you to follow to prevent an attack or quickly recover your data if you detect an attack:

1. Prepare in advance by doing daily back up of your files for easy recovery.
2. Use two hard drives. Use a 10 Gb hard-drive for your C: drive. Use a bigger hard-drive for all your other data.
3. Keep all receipts, registration, and activation codes and other information on a CD. You may need these to contact the seller in an emergency to prove that you already bought their product.
4. Scan your C:drive daily. This is where most virus infections are found. Since this is a small drive, this process will go relatively quickly.
5. Scan your larger drive once every two weeks.
6. You can use CD and DVD burners or removable hard drives for your back-ups.
7. Use a high-quality anti-virus program for prevention and detection.

Identification, Research, And Downloading The Antidote

While these 7 steps will help keep your computer safe and help you recover if your computer is attacked by a virus, what do you do if a virus has broken past your defenses? How do you remove virus from your computer after detection? If the virus is spyware or adware, you can use anti-spyware and anti-adware from NoAdware program to detect and quarantine them. Also Spywaremover has an excellent reputation.

The best way to get excellent programs for removing spyware, adware, and other malicious software, is to get the information from an authority website.

If you want to remove a virus, you have to find out what type of virus it is first, then you have to do some internet research on forums or other places where you can get unbiased information about the best authority sites.

For example, suppose you detected a Trojan virus. You would then go to an anti-virus authority site like Majorgeek.com and download "Trojan Remover."
Here is a description from their website of this particular example of how to remove virus from your computer:

"Trojan Remover was written to aid in the removal of Trojan Horses from a computer where standard anti-virus software has either failed to detect the Trojan Horse or is unable to effectively eliminate it. In no way should it be considered as an alternative to regularly using good anti-virus software to protect your computer."

Once the description matches your virus, download it and use it.

In summary, here are three steps to take to remove virus from your computer.

1. Prevent it from happening in the first place and make sure that you back up your data and important information in case it does happen.
2. Constantly monitor your computer for an invasion. Don't wait to detect it after you have lost your data.
3. Identify the name of the virus, then do an Internet search for the remedy from an authority site that deals with virus removal and download their latest program.
